首页 > 解决方案 > 从终端运行 Gulp 命令

问题描述

我第一次使用在线教程在 MAMP 环境中设计 Wordpress 主题。

我是 Gulp 和 SASS 的新手,我正在尝试从我的 Mac 上的文件夹运行/执行 Gulp,但似乎无法在终端中正确获取命令。

我已经成功运行并安装了 Gulp,但无法获得该过程的下一部分(本教程仅提供 Windows 的说明)。

我知道我必须在 上执行“运行”命令,但我一直弄错。

简而言之,终端中的“运行”或“执行”文件命令应该是什么样的?

标签: wordpresssassgulp

解决方案


在您的终端中,到目前为止您运行了哪些命令。检查 node、npm、npx 和 gulp 检查它们是否已安装的快速方法是使用这些命令。

node --version

npm --version

npx --version

那么你有 gulpfile.js 文件吗?如果不运行此命令

npx -p touch nodetouch gulpfile.js

然后在文件中添加您的 SASS 命令。

例如

'use strict';

var gulp = require('gulp');
var sass = require('gulp-sass');

sass.compiler = require('node-sass');

gulp.task('sass', function () {
  return gulp.src('./sass/**/*.scss')
    .pipe(sass().on('error', sass.logError))
    .pipe(gulp.dest('./css'));
});

gulp.task('sass:watch', function () {
  gulp.watch('./sass/**/*.scss', ['sass']);
});

要运行 gulp,请确保您位于包含 gulpfile.js 的目录中。

gulp

这是让您在 mac 终端上使用 Gulp 的快速入门。 https://gulpjs.com/docs/en/getting-started/quick-start

希望有帮助。


推荐阅读